Research

CWI has a 50-strong team of academics, postdocs, PhD students and engineers who develop innovative underpinning technologies for physical layer wireless.

Since CWI’s inception, our mission has been to develop truly disruptive, end-to-end physical layer wireless technologies and techniques that will assist in the creation of a data-driven, hyper-connected society.

Our researchers focus on two primary themes of investigation -- RF through THz Systems, and Signal Processing and Communication Theory. 

Underlying these two primary themes are six, grand challenged focused, sub themes:

  • Future Cellular Systems (5G & Beyond, 6G)
  • Electromagnetic Sensing (incl. Imaging)
  • Green Wireless (Wireless Power Transfer, Energy scavenging, …)
  • Space Applications (Antenna designs)
  • Connected & Autonomous Systems (IoT, Body Area networks, …)
  • Physical Layer Secure Wireless
